Output ec7f0627120ea0f06b5f6d82dc5207e966848c466aaeeab46023e04d93a9add6:0

value
518900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64afc41b2990a6fa6f817003f29ae536538194a5 OP_EQUALVERIFY OP_CHECKSIG
address
1ABP8d3wHUP51HqsXHbTRxtU1Mok15RXki
transaction
ec7f0627120ea0f06b5f6d82dc5207e966848c466aaeeab46023e04d93a9add6
spent
true